[QUOTE="decept, post: 396011, member: 90000"] [b]TV-Server Version[/b]: 1.0 [b]MediaPortal Version[/b]: 1.0 [b]MediaPortal Skin[/b]: default [b]Windows Version[/b]: TV-Server: WHS, TV-Client: Vista 32 Ultimate [b]TV Card[/b]: Hauppauge PVR250 I'm a new to MediaPortal and I have a problem with the TV aspect-ratio when watching/recording TV. I have searched for hours for a way to solve this. I have connected my DVB-S receiver (Dreambox 500s) to the video-in on my Hauppauge PVR250 using an svhs cable. I have set the receiver to output svhs in 16:9. As far as I know this means that it sends 16:9 stretched to 4:3 (anamorphic), correct? The problem is that in MediaPortal the TV image is always stretched to 4:3 and none of the aspect-ratio settings makes it right. Unless I run MediaPortal in fullscreen on a 16:9 display with the "stretch" setting, then ofcourse everything is fine. But that is not my normal setup. Isn't there supposed to be a flag or somethine sent along the video-feed to tell that it's anamorphic? If so is MediaPortal capable of dealing with that? Otherwise, is there a way to add a 16:9 option in the aspect-ratio list? It is also possible that the receiver isn't sending the anamorphic-flag (if there is such a thing), I wouldn't be suprised. If that's the case then I need a way to tell MediaPortal that the signal is 16:9 anamorphic. I have a computer with only the TV-Server part of MediaPortal and several others using Vista and Win7 with the TV-Client. The problem appears on all the clients. If I record and then watch the recording in MediaPortal or any other media player, the image is stretched to 4:3. [/QUOTE]
